Student Internships

Outstanding professional educational experience and training in the areas of advertising, public relations, marketing and fundraising in a non-profit arts environment. Interns are individually supervised by department staff and involved in day-to-day operations, plus assigned clerical and administrative tasks, such as information market research, filing, database management, and material distribution. Intern special projects may include writing press releases, planning and coordination of special events, developing material for the web site, creating promotional offers, and proofreading. Computer proficiency in Word, Excel, page layout tools preferred.

Patron Services Associate

Position: Full-time (40 hours per week)
Salary: Entry-level
Revised Hours: Tuesday through Friday noon - 8 pm; Saturday 9 am - 5 pm

This position reports to the Director of Education, and works with the staff, faculty, volunteers, patrons and school families. The person in this position is the key customer service representative for the Music School and the Box Office manager for performances. The Patron Services Associate will perform a wide variety of tasks to support the entire organization (Education, Performance an Outreach).

P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ES:

Customer Service/Office Reception: Provide quality customer service to support the mission of Indian Hill Music and our community of students, families, faculty and staff. Front desk reception; answer and direct phone calls, voice mails and general emails; respond to general inquiries about the organization; provide facility tours for prospective students. Maintain working knowledge of all concerts, ancillary events, programming, venue particulars, guest artists.
Receive registrations, deposits and payments, and assist school families in completing and understanding forms, and all other registration tasks as needed . Respond to requests for gift certificates and vouchers, create documents and maintain records.

Data Management/Mailings: Data entry and maintenance of database info for the music school, mail and email lists, and ability to extract targeted lists for mailings; preparation of bulk mailings and all general mailings as needed; work with Director of Volunteers to secure volunteers for large projects; prepare targeted mailings to communities, groups and organizations, and maintain mailing lists; sort and distribute mail to staff; proof materials for organizational events and programs.

Box Office/Performance: Process single ticket, subscription and event sales from all sources; monitor and respond to ticket line voice mail; revise ticket line phone messages and building signage; run ticket sales reports; prepare front-of-house needs and supplies for Orchestra of Indian Hill concerts; set up box office and work OIH concerts, and other performances as needed.

Clerical & Other Administrative Tasks: Prepare bank deposits; distribute payroll checks; assist Director of Finance with accounts payable process and file paid invoices; run reports for daily credit card transactions; log and track staff vacation and personal days. Maintain general information files and binders, sign-up sheets for workshops, and internal lists of staff, faculty, Board and other important contacts; coordinate Blackman Hall booking process and calendar; take reservations for Bach’s Lunch concert series and manage seating chart. Coordinate scheduling of recitals and recital accompanists, compile and create recital programs; reserve studio space and provide updates to staff/faculty.
Order, track inventory and organize office supplies, equipment supplies, postage, cleaning supplies; communicate with business machines vendors for repairs and maintenance of equipment

QUALIFICATIONS:

Bachelor’s degree or equivalent life experience. Basic knowledge of music and instruments. Proven record of exemplary customer service, professional interpersonal and communication skills, excellent computer skills including Microsoft Access, Excel, Publisher and Word. Must be organized, detail oriented, efficient and accurate. Ability to work independently, multi-task, and to handle a busy front desk environment.

Artistic Director - Regional Children’s Chorus

Position: Part-time
Salary: Commensurate with experience

Indian Hill Music School is seeking an energetic and talented Artistic Director to help create and direct a comprehensive Regional Children's Choral Program, slated to begin in September 2010. Ideal candidate will have a Bachelor's or Master's Degree in Music, working knowledge of Kodaly techniques, excellent conducting skills and thorough knowledge of appropriate choral repertoire for ages 8-18. Prior experience working with children's voices preferred. Program will develop musicianship, vocal and ensemble skills for beginning to advanced singers, ages 8-18. Part-time administrative duties will begin in spring 2010 and will continue through summer 2010.
